My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Maggie is a 4 year old full Saint Bernard. Bear is a 3 year old full Saint Bernard. Both Maggie and Bear are beautiful rough-coats. They are fabulous Saints that were owner surrenders due to a divorce. She and Bear have the same mother but different fathers. They came from two different litters.
Maggie is housetrained, spayed and up to date on vaccinations. Bear will be neutered on July 3rd. He is also housetrained and up to date on vaccinations. They are both so sweet. They both get along with other dogs, cats and kids. They know many commands. These two are very bonded and love each other unconditionally. The perfect home for them would be if someone would adopt them together.

In concern for families with small children, we will not adopt a dog to a home with any child under the age of 5. This is due to the large size of Saint Bernards and the safety of your children. Our Saint Bernards are not aggressive or mean in any way, they can just knock down children easily.
